replacement mat for paper piercing
 
I have used my mat from my stampin'up mat pack so much that I would like to get a new one. I would like it bigger if possible. Anyone have any ideas?

Anita R 04-27-2010 06:42 PM

An old-style mouse pad will work well.

Anita

Barbara Jay 04-27-2010 06:54 PM

The Thicker Funky Foam works fine.

Cook22 04-28-2010 12:58 AM

I've used both the above, but for me a cork tile works best of all.

I am absolutely mad for a homemade piercing mat that I made from 4 layers of fun foam.

I buy the big sheets or roll of fun foam & cut them to be 12x12. The mat fits in my scor-pal that way & it is AWEsome! I use a tim holtz design ruler & 2/3 thick T pins to hold it in place & a making memories deluxe paper piercer. I spent a lot of moulah to get what is now the "winning combination" (tried the SU pack & piercer (too short for me & the plastic wore out so I got crooked lines... and I tried a few other piercers, but found the holes they made too big etc...)

I couldn't be happier now AND having the 12x12 surface to work on it so loverly! Works wonders for me anyhow...
